add_component('section', 'options-pages', 'options', $lang->string('Options'), null); $navigator->add_component('link', 'options-pages-home', 'options-pages', $lang->string('Home'), 'index.php'); $navigator->add_component('link', 'options-pages-settings', 'options-pages', $lang->string('Bugdar Settings'), 'setting.php'); $navigator->add_component('link', 'options-pages-languages', 'options-pages', $lang->string('Languages'), 'language.php'); $navigator->add_component('link', 'options-pages-userhelp', 'options-pages', $lang->string('User Help Items'), 'userhelp.php'); } // ################################################################### /** * Adding a new language * * @access public */ function languagesAdd() { global $navigator, $lang; $navigator->add_component('section', 'options-languages', 'options', $lang->string('Languages'), null); $navigator->add_component('link', 'options-languages-add', 'options-languages', $lang->string('Add New Language'), 'language.php?do=add'); } // ################################################################### /** * Edit a language * * @access public * * @param integer Language ID */ function languagesEdit($id) { global $navigator, $lang; NavLinks::languagesAdd(); $navigator->add_component('link', 'options-languages-edit', 'options-languages', $lang->string('Edit Language'), 'language.php?do=edit&languageid=' . $id); $navigator->add_component('link', 'options-languages-reload', 'options-languages', $lang->string('Reload XML'), 'language.php?do=reload&languageid=' . $id); $navigator->add_component('link', 'options-languages-delete', 'options-languages', $lang->string('Delete'), 'language.php?do=delete&languageid=' . $id); } // ################################################################### /** * Adding a new user help item * * @access public */ function userhelpAdd() { global $navigator, $lang; $navigator->add_component('section', 'options-userhelp', 'options', $lang->string('User Help Items'), null); $navigator->add_component('link', 'options-userhelp-add', 'options-userhelp', $lang->string('Add New Item'), 'userhelp.php?do=add'); } // ################################################################### /** * Adding a new product * * @access public */ function productsAdd() { global $navigator, $lang; $navigator->add_component('section', 'products', 'products', $lang->string('Products'), null); $navigator->add_component('link', 'products-manage', 'products', $lang->string('Manage Products'), 'product.php'); $navigator->add_component('link', 'products-add', 'products', $lang->string('Add New Product'), 'product.php?do=addproduct'); } // ################################################################### /** * Editing a product * * @access public * * @param integer Product ID */ function productsEdit($id) { global $navigator, $lang; NavLinks::productsAdd(); $navigator->add_component('section', 'products-edit', 'products', $lang->string('Edit Product'), null); $navigator->add_component('link', 'products-edit', 'products-edit', $lang->string('Edit Product'), 'product.php?do=editproduct&productid=' . $id); $navigator->add_component('link', 'products-edit-version', 'products-edit', $lang->string('Add New Version'), 'product.php?do=addversion&productid=' . $id); $navigator->add_component('link', 'products-edit-delete', 'products-edit', $lang->string('Delete Product'), 'product.php?do=deleteproduct&productid=' . $id); } } /*=====================================================================*\ || ################################################################### || # $HeadURL$ || # $Id$ || ################################################################### \*=====================================================================*/ ?>